Project Type Typical Range
Water Damage Restoration $1,200 - $4,000
Fire Damage Restoration $3,500 - $8,000
Mold Remediation $1,500 - $4,000
Storm Damage Repair $2,000 - $7,000
Content Cleaning & Restoration $1,200 - $3,500
Structural Drying $2,000 - $6,000

Disaster restoration services in Grayson, GA, involve restoring properties affected by events such as water damage, fire, storms, or mold. Understanding the typical scope and costs of these projects can help property owners plan effectively and compare options for their restoration needs.

  • Materials Used: Restoration projects often involve materials like drywall, insulation, flooring, and ceiling components, selected based on the extent of damage and building standards.
  • Size and Scope: Projects can range from small room repairs to large-scale building restorations, depending on the affected area and severity of damage.
  • Labor Complexity: The complexity of labor varies with factors such as the type of damage, required demolition, and the extent of structural repairs.
  • Permitting Requirements: Some restoration work may require permits from local authorities, especially for structural changes or significant repairs.
  • Additional Services: Extra services may include mold remediation, odor removal, or specialized drying techniques, which can influence overall project costs and timelines.
